返回

突破技术瓶颈:解锁移动端开发新境界

闲谈

对于任何开发者而言,遇到技术瓶颈都是不可避免的。特别是像移动端开发这样发展迅速、技术迭代频繁的领域,如果不持续进取,很容易被时代潮流所淘汰。本文将从多个维度深入剖析突破技术瓶颈的方法,帮助你解锁移动端开发新境界。

深入学习:夯实基础,拓展知识面

技术瓶颈的根源往往在于知识面的不足。要突破瓶颈,首要任务就是拓展知识面,夯实基础。

  • 系统学习移动端开发基础知识: 包括操作系统原理、移动架构、UI设计、网络通信等核心概念。
  • 掌握主流开发语言和框架: 如 Java、Kotlin、Swift、React Native 等。
  • 了解移动端开发工具和技术: 如 IDE、版本控制工具、调试工具等。

深入学习的途径有很多,例如阅读书籍、观看视频教程、参加在线课程等。重要的是选择适合自己的方式,并持之以恒地学习。

项目实战:学以致用,积累经验

纸上得来终觉浅,绝知此事要躬行。在深入学习的基础上,项目实战是突破技术瓶颈的最佳途径。

  • 参与开源项目: 加入活跃的开源项目,与其他开发者协作,了解真实世界的项目开发流程和最佳实践。
  • 构建个人项目: 从头开始构建自己的移动端应用,实践从需求分析、设计到实现的整个开发过程。
  • 参加编程竞赛: 参加编程竞赛可以锻炼你的快速学习和解决问题的能力。

项目实战不仅可以让你巩固所学知识,还能提升你的动手能力和解决实际问题的能力。

技术交流:开阔视野,取长补短

技术交流是突破技术瓶颈的另一重要途径。与同行交流可以开阔你的视野,获取不同的视角和见解。

  • 加入技术社区: 加入相关的技术社区,参与讨论,分享知识和经验。
  • 参加技术会议和研讨会: 参加行业会议和研讨会,了解前沿技术和行业趋势。
  • 与资深开发者交流: 向经验丰富的开发者请教,学习他们的经验和解决问题的方法。

技术交流不仅可以帮助你了解新技术,还能拓展你的职业网络,获得宝贵的指导和支持。

保持热情,勇于探索

突破技术瓶颈是一个持续的过程,需要保持热情和探索精神。

  • 保持学习心态: 不要满足于现状,始终保持好奇心,不断探索新技术和知识。
  • 勇于接受挑战: 不要畏惧挑战,遇到困难时,积极寻求解决方案,勇于走出舒适区。
  • 寻求导师或教练: 寻找一位经验丰富的导师或教练,为你的学习和成长提供指导和支持。

保持热情,勇于探索,你就能不断突破自己的极限,成为一名更出色的移动端开发工程师。

突破技术瓶颈并非易事,但只要掌握正确的方法,并持之以恒地努力,你就能解锁移动端开发的新境界。深入学习、项目实战、技术交流和保持热情,这些方法将助力你成为一名更全面、更出色的移动端开发工程师。